Dragonhawk1066 Posted June 6, 2021 Author Posted June 6, 2021 (edited) I had to call a last minute audible on the wheels, as the rears just wouldn't quite fit right inside the fenderwells. I tried shaving the wheel backs to no avail and the only solution was to grind away the inner fenderwells, which I was just unwilling to do at this stage. I also bent one of the rims while working on the fit, and couldn't get it back to a decent round shape. I had a minor conundrum as to which rims/tires to go with, Convo Pro's with skinnier slicks or steal the deep dish rims off my brown '69 Camaro and keep the drag radials. The wife preferred the rally's, so the conundrum was short-lived, lol. I painted and detailed a pair of the kit rally's for the front after these pics were taken and while they are molded a little differently than the rears, I can live with it. The lower left is the bent rim, which looked even worse in the tire. The paint also wrinkled while trying to fix it. I pretty much finished this one today, even with the wheel issue and hope to get some good outdoor pics tomorrow. Edited June 6, 2021 by Dragonhawk1066
